.SH DESCRIPTION
|
|
.PP
|
|
\fBTk_GetReliefFromObj\fR places in \fI*reliefPtr\fR the relief value
|
|
corresponding to the value of \fIobjPtr\fR. This value will be one of
|
|
\fBTK_RELIEF_FLAT\fR, \fBTK_RELIEF_RAISED\fR, \fBTK_RELIEF_SUNKEN\fR,
|
|
\fBTK_RELIEF_GROOVE\fR, \fBTK_RELIEF_SOLID\fR, or \fBTK_RELIEF_RIDGE\fR.
|
|
Under normal circumstances the return value is \fBTCL_OK\fR and
|
|
\fIinterp\fR is unused.
|
|
If \fIobjPtr\fR does not contain one of the valid relief names
|
|
or an abbreviation of one of them, then \fBTCL_ERROR\fR is returned,
|
|
\fI*reliefPtr\fR is unmodified, and an error message
|
|
is stored in \fIinterp\fR's result if \fIinterp\fR is not NULL.
|
|
\fBTk_GetReliefFromObj\fR caches information about the return
|
|
value in \fIobjPtr\fR, which speeds up future calls to
|
|
\fBTk_GetReliefFromObj\fR with the same \fIobjPtr\fR.
|
|
.PP
|
|
\fBTk_GetRelief\fR is identical to \fBTk_GetReliefFromObj\fR except
|
|
that the description of the relief is specified with a string instead
|
|
of an object. This prevents \fBTk_GetRelief\fR from caching the
|
|
return value, so \fBTk_GetRelief\fR is less efficient than
|
|
\fBTk_GetReliefFromObj\fR.
|
|
.PP
|
|
\fBTk_NameOfRelief\fR is the logical inverse of \fBTk_GetRelief\fR.
|
|
Given a relief value it returns the corresponding string (\fBflat\fR,
|
|
\fBraised\fR, \fBsunken\fR, \fBgroove\fR, \fBsolid\fR, or \fBridge\fR).
|
|
If \fIrelief\fR is not a legal relief value, then
|
|
.QW "unknown relief"
|
|
is returned.
